Change Team Project 3: Editing HTML5 & CSS For Responsive Web Pages

In the modern web, one of the biggest challenges facing developers is creating web pages which accurately respond to the browser size of the device it is being viewed on. In this project students will learn how to access a portable HTML editor on a flash drive, open up HTML & CSS pages and edit the code of a responsive web page.
